
You have most probably heard about Seoul’s famous mountain, Bukhansan. Situated in the northern park of the city (Dobongsan station- line 7), It has been designated as a national park since 1983. The meaning behind the name is literally “big mountain in the north”. The mountain has multiple sharp peaks that contrast with the forest […]